Pharmacokinetics of Andrographolide Sodium Bisulphite and its Related Substance in Rats by Liquid Chromatography–Tandem Mass Spectrometry
Journal of Analytical Chemistry ( IF 1.0 ) Pub Date : 2020-07-31 , DOI: 10.1134/s1061934820080183
Shuang-Qing Zhang , Xinghe Wang , Yan Zhang , Xiuting Li

Abstract

Acute renal failure caused by Lianbizhi® injection can be attributed to andrographolide sodium bisulphite (ASB) and its main related substance RS413. For the safety evaluation of ASB and RS413, the pharmacokinetics of both compounds in rats was investigated through a liquid chromatography-tandem mass spectrometry method. After a simple protein precipitation with methanol, ASB and RS413 with dehydroandrographolide as an internal standard in plasma were separated on a C18 column using gradient elution with methanol and water and detected in the negative selected reaction monitoring mode. The intra- and inter-day accuracies of the method varied from 96 to 107% over the concentration range of 10–1000 ng/mL. Precisions were within 7.8% and the extraction recoveries ranged between 71–99% without obvious matrix effects. The method was applied for the simultaneous quantification of ASB and RS413 in rats treated intravenously with ASB and RS413 at the dose of 80 mg/kg for the first time.

液相色谱-串联质谱法测定穿心莲内酯亚硫酸氢钠及其相关物质的药代动力学

摘要

Lianbizhi®注射引起的急性肾功能衰竭可归因于穿心莲内酯亚硫酸氢钠(ASB)及其主要相关物质RS413。为了评估ASB和RS413的安全性,通过液相色谱-串联质谱法研究了这两种化合物在大鼠中的药代动力学。用甲醇简单沉淀后,将血浆中以脱水穿心莲内酯为内标的ASB和RS413分离在C 18上色谱柱,使用甲醇和水进行梯度洗脱,并以阴性选定的反应监测模式进行检测。在10–1000 ng / mL的浓度范围内,该方法的日内和日间准确性从96%到107%不等。精密度在7.8%以内,萃取回收率在71–99%之间,没有明显的基质影响。该方法用于首次定量以80 mg / kg剂量的ASB和RS413静脉治疗的大鼠中ASB和RS413的同时定量。
